8-1421. "Flammable liquid" defined.
"Flammable liquid" means any liquid which has a flash point of 70 degrees Fahrenheit, or less, as determined by a tagliabue or equivalent closed-cup test device.

History: L. 1974, ch. 33, § 8-1421; July 1.
